Windows下Node.js的下载安装,Node、npm的配置,vscode的下载,vscode从git拉去项目,编译并运行

一、Node.js的下载安装

1、打开node.js的官网Node.js 中文网,根据自己的电脑选择适合自己的Node.js安装包,可以选择v14.18.3那个版本,版本过高可能会导致性能不匹配等问题。

2、下载完成之后打开下载好的安装包,开始下载

   

默认安装路径为C盘,由于C盘空间有限,将安装路径改为D盘 

 

 

 

3、到此就下载成功了,可以在cmd中输入node -v、npm-v,查看node是否返回node和npm的版本号,出现此界面,说明安装成功

二、 Node、npm的配置

    node和npm并不是下载好就可以直接使用的,须在系统环境变量中进行设置才可以进行使用

1、先进行全局模块路径和缓存路径的配置

全局模块路径默认放在C盘下,但由于我们C盘空间不足,尽量放到其他盘下,这里推荐放到node.js的安装路径下,在node.js的安装包下新建两个文件夹,分别命名为node_global和node_cache,对应分别是全局模块路径和缓存路径

cmd打开命令行窗口,输入

npm config set prefix "D:\Program Files\nodejs\node_global"
npm config set cache "D:\Program Files\nodejs\node_cache"

2、再进行环境变量的配置

右击此电脑,点击属性,选择高级系统设置,点击环境变量

在用户变量中寻找path,点击path,将C:\Users\lenovo\AppData\Roaming\npm修改为D:\Program Files\nodejs\node_global

在系统变量中新建变量,变量名为NODE_PATH,变量值为D:\Program Files\nodejs\node_global\node_modules,在系统变量中寻找path,进行编辑,新建变量值D:\Program Files\nodejs\node_global\node_modules,点击确定进行保存,最终的环境变量配置如下:

 

到此node、npm的环境变量配置结束 

三、Visual Studio Code的下载

点击此链接进行vscode的下载,VSCodeUserSetup-x64-1.63.2.exe,下载成功之后,点击安装包进行安装,安装成功之后,搜索Chinese,点击install,然后restart

四、从git拉取项目,并在VS code中编译运行

1、打开git,找到所拉项目的url地址,复制。创建一个空文件夹,打开该文件夹,并在该文件夹下cmd打开命令行界面,输入git clone +你复制的项目URL地址,回车即克隆成功

2、打开VS code,在VS code中打开拉取到的文件夹,新建终端

3、在VS Code界面中,ctrl+p输入Config,点击vue.config.js,配置自己的接口代理服务

4、配置成功之后,输入npm install进行项目编译,编译成功之后,输入npm run dev,以开发者模式运行项目,运行成功之后点击终端控制台输出的IP地址进行界面的访问

注:

1、下载node.js,最好下载v14.18.3,v16版本太高会导致性能不匹配;

2、进行了全局模块路径的配置和缓存路径配置之后,一定要进行环境变量的配置,否则cmd将报无法识别node的命令错误;

3、修改环境变量时,用户变量和系统变量均要修改,path和node path都要进行添加和修改;

4、配置自己的接口代理服务时,一定要找到自己电脑的IP地址,正确输入,否则代理无效,我在第一次忘记了修改自己的接口代理IP,在没有修改接口代理服务的情况下,进行了npm install项目的编译,然后进行了npm run dev项目运行,发现报了无法代理接口服务的错误,意识到了自己没有修改接口IP地址。进行修改之后,并没有清除缓存就又一次进行了npm install和npm run dev,运行时又报了431和500错误,究其原因就是我没有清除缓存,node_module下边依赖包出了问题,修改之后必须清除缓存,然后重新进行编译打包最后再运行,否则百度找到的任何错误的解决办法都雨你无瓜。

 

 

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

余悸-Shine

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值